Wolf Creek National Fish Hatchery
The Wolf Creek National Fish Hatchery (NFH) was established in 1975. Our mission is to provide rainbow and brown trout for mitigation stocking in Kentucky; provide a refuge for threatened or endangered aquatic species and develop techniques required to culture these species; and establish and maintain a ?Friends Group? to gain community support for the fish hatchery. For more than 150,000 visitors yearly, we provide hatchery tours, off-site presentations, a display room, and a handicapped accessible public fishing area. In June we open the Annual Kids Fishing Derby held during National Fishing Week.
